The CIO- and PCIM-DDA06 Series supports the following UL and UL for .NET features.

Analog output

Functions

UL: cbAOut(), cbVOut(), cbAOutScan()

UL for .NET: AOut(), VOut(), AOutScan()

Options

SIMULTANEOUS (CIO-DDA06 Series only)

HighChan

0 to 5

Count

HighChan - LowChan + 1 max

Rate

Ignored

Range

Ignored - not programmable

CIO-DDA06/Jr and CIO-DDA06/Jr/16:

Fixed at BIP5VOLTS (±5 volts)

CIO-DDA06/16 and PCIM-DDA06/16: fixed at one of four switch-selectable ranges:

BIP10VOLTS (±10 volts)UNI10VOLTS (0 to 10 volts)
BIP5VOLTS (±5 volts)UNI5VOLTS (0 to 5 volts)

CIO-DDA06/12: fixed at one of eight switch-selectable ranges:

BIP10VOLTS (±10 volts)UNI10VOLTS (0 to 10 volts)
BIP5VOLTS (±5 volts)UNI5VOLTS (0 to 5 volts)
BIP2PT5VOLTS (±2.5 volts)UNI2VOLTS (0 to 2.5 volts)
BIP1PT67VOLTS (±1.67 volt)UNI1VOLTS (0 to 1.67 volt)

DataValue

0 to 4,095

For /16 hardware, the following argument values are also valid:

0 to 65,535 (Refer to 16-bit values using a signed integer data type for information on 16-bit values using unsigned integers.)

Digital I/O

cbDConfigPort() port reference cbDIn(), cbDOut() port reference Values cbDBitIn(), cbDBitOut() port reference Bit Number
FIRSTPORTAFIRSTPORTA0-255FIRSTPORTA0 to 7
FIRSTPORTBFIRSTPORTB0-255FIRSTPORTA8 to 15
FIRSTPORTCLFIRSTPORTCL0-15FIRSTPORTA16 to 19
FIRSTPORTCHFIRSTPORTCH0-15FIRSTPORTA20 to 23

Functions

UL: cbDOut(), cbDIn(), cbDBitIn(), cbDBitOut(), cbDConfigPort()

UL for .NET: DOut(), DIn(), DBitIn(), DBitOut(), DConfigPort()

PortNum

FIRSTPORTA, FIRSTPORTB, FIRSTPORTCL, FIRSTPORTCH

DataValue

0 to 255 for FIRSTPORTA or FIRSTPORTB

0 to 15 for FIRSTPORTC

BitNum

0 to 23 for FIRSTPORTA

Hardware considerations

Pacing analog output

Software only

Initializing the "zero power-up" state

When using the CIO-DDA06 "zero power-up state" hardware option, use cbAOutScan()/ AOutScan() to set the desired output value and enable the DAC outputs.
